Chicken Wing Dip Recipe

Ingredients:  
Ingredients:  
1 8 oz pkg light or regular cream cheese, softened
1/3 c hot sauce
1/2 c ranch or blue cheese dressing
1 1/4 c diced cooked chicken
1/ c sharp shredded cheddar cheese

Directions:
Directions:
Preheat oven to 350 º. Combine all ingredients and spread into pie plate. Bake for 30 minutes. If oil collects on top of dip, dab with a paper towel. Serve warm with tortilla chips.

Number Of Servings:
Number Of Servings:
8
Preparation Time:
Preparation Time:
10 minutes
Personal Notes:
Personal Notes:
This wonderful hot dip recipe was given to me by my good friend Nancy. I was shocked to learn that it has bleu cheese dressing in it, because I am not a fan of bleu cheese. For those like me, you can substitute ranch dressing or use a combo of both!
